President Beppe Marotta argued that Christian Cibb was not the “second choice” behind Cesc Fabregas, and the club decided not to sell very strong players this summer.

“We’ll start as well as every year that respects the history and colour of this club,” Marotta told Sky Sports Italia.
“We also have very strong opponents who challenge the same targets. Napoli won the Scudetto last season, so they have to start their next campaign and be considered their favorite.

Nerazzurri didn’t keep the fact that he wanted to keep Simone Inzaghi on the bench even after finishing empty-handed last season, but he left to take over Al-Hilal.
The search for the exchange went through Fabregas, but eventually settled on former Palma boss Chibu, but Marotta had this framing wrong.
“The club has a project and Chivu fits into it very well,” the president told Sky Sport Italia.
“I heard all this story about Fabregas being the first option, but that wasn’t a situation. He was one of the names on the list, but Chive certainly wasn’t the second option or the person we settled on.
“Chib has a long history with Inter as a player and then as a coach at a successful Youth Academy for many years. He fits perfectly with the profile of what we were looking for.”

It was a tough transfer session for Inter and Marotta couldn’t deny that some transactions didn’t go as they wanted, but he tried to see the positive side again.
The past few months have been ruled alongside Hakan Karhanogul’s Give Give and Galatasarei, and have not convinced Atalanta to sell Ademalake Man.
“We decided not to sell very strong players and tried to find some opportunities in the market, but we can’t go overboard,” continued Marotta.
“Lookman was a chance, but Atalanta decided not to put him on the market as fully as their rights. We then tried to add a younger player to this team. We’re planning a team that fits our plans.
“We lowered the average age of our team and brought in new talented players.”
